書名: APCS 完全攻略:從新手到高手,Python 解題必備!【好評回饋版】 (3版)
作者: 胡昭民, 吳燦銘
版次: 3
ISBN: 9786264140799
出版社: 博碩
出版日期: 2024/12
頁數: 400
定價: 650
售價: 585
庫存: 已售完
LINE US! 詢問這本書 團購優惠、書籍資訊 等
此書籍已售完,調書籍需2-5工作日。建議與有庫存書籍分開下單

付款方式: 超商取貨付款 line pay
信用卡 全支付
線上轉帳 Apple pay
物流方式: 超商取貨
宅配
門市自取

為您推薦

APCS 完全攻略:從新手到高手,C++ 解題必備!【好評回饋版】 (3版)

APCS 完全攻略:從新手到高手,C++ 解題必備!【好評回饋版】 (3版)

類似書籍推薦給您

原價: 690 售價: 621 現省: 69元
立即查看
APCS 完全攻略:從新手到高手,C語言解題必備! (1版)

APCS 完全攻略:從新手到高手,C語言解題必備! (1版)

類似書籍推薦給您

APCS 完全攻略:從新手到高手,C語言解題必備! 系列名:單行本 ISBN13:9786263331914 出版社:博碩文化 作者:胡昭民;吳燦銘 裝訂/頁數:平裝/456頁 規格:26cm*19cm*2.1cm (高/寬/厚) 出版日:2022/08/08 中國圖書分類:電腦程式語言 內容簡介 \滿級分快速攻略/ 重點總整理 + 歷次試題解析 ☑ 結合運算思維與演算法的基本觀念 ☑ 章節架構清晰,涵蓋 APCS 考試重點 ☑ 備有相關模擬試題,幫助釐清重點觀念 ☑ 詳細解析 APCS 程式設計觀念題與實作題 APCS 為 Advanced Placement Computer Science 的英文縮寫,是指「大學程式設計先修檢測」。目的是提供學生自我評量程式設計能力及評量大學程式設計先修課程學習成效。其檢測成績可作為國內多所資訊相關科系個人申請入學的參考資料。 APCS 考試類型包括:程式設計觀念題及程式設計實作題。在程式設計觀念題是以單選題的方式進行測驗,以運算思維、問題解決與程式設計概念測試為主。測驗題型包括程式運行追蹤、程式填空、程式除錯、程式效能分析及基礎觀念理解等。而程式設計觀念題的考試重點包括:程式設計基本觀念、輸出入指令、資料型態、常數與變數、全域及區域、流程控制、迴圈、函式、遞迴、陣列與矩陣、結構、自定資料型態及檔案,也包括基礎演算法及簡易資料結構,例如:佇列、堆疊、串列、樹狀、排序、搜尋。在程式設計實作題以撰寫完整程式或副程式為主,可自行選擇以 C、C++、Java、Python 撰寫程式。 本書的實作題以 C 語言來進行問題分析及程式實作。實作題的解答部份可分為四大架構:解題重點分析、完整程式碼、執行結果及程式碼說明。在「解題重點分析」單元中知道本實作題的程式設計重點、解題技巧、變數功能及演算法,此單元會配合適當的程式碼輔助解說,來降低學習者的障礙。 同時也可以參考附錄的內容來幫助自己熟悉 APCS 的測試環境。此外,為了讓學習者以較簡易的環境撰寫程式,本書所有程式以 Dev C++ 的 IDE 進行程式的編輯、編譯與執行。希望透過本書的課程安排與訓練,可以讓學習者培養出以 C 語言應試 APCS 的實戰能力。 【目標讀者】 ◆ 欲申請大學資訊相關科系的高中職生 ◆ 對程式語言有興趣的學習者 ◆ 想客觀檢測自己程式設計能力的人   目錄 CHAPTER|01|認識 APCS 資訊能力檢測 1-1 認識 APCS 資訊能力檢測 1-2 APCS 考試類型說明 CHAPTER|02|運算思維與C程式設計基本觀念 2-1 認識運算思維 2-1-1 拆解 2-1-2 模式識別 2-1-3 歸納與抽象化 2-1-4 演算法 2-2 程式設計簡介 2-2-1 程式設計步驟與注意事項 2-2-2 結構化程式設計 2-2-3 物件導向程式設計 2-3 資料型態 2-3-1 基本資料型態(Primitive Data Type) 2-3-2 結構化資料型態(Structured Data Type) 2-3-3 抽象資料型態(Abstract Data Type:ADT) 2-4 數字系統介紹 2-4-1 數字系統轉換方式 2-5 運算子 2-5-1 指定運算子 2-5-2 算術運算子 2-5-3 關係運算子 2-5-4 邏輯運算子 2-5-5 位元運算子 2-6 資料型態轉換 2-6-1 自動型態轉換 2-6-2 強制型態轉換 2-7 變數與常數 2-8-1 變數 2-8-2 常數 2-8 可視範圍(scope) 2-8-1 全域變數 2-8-2 區域變數(local variable) 2-9 輸入與輸出 2-9-1 printf()函數 2-9-2 scanf()函數 2-10 前置處理器與巨集 2-10-1 #include 指令 2-10-2 #define 指令 2-11 本章相關模擬試題 CHAPTER|03|流程控制結構 3-1 選擇結構 3-1-1 if指令 3-1-2 if else 指令 3-1-3 條件運算子 3-1-4 switch指令 3-2 迴圈結構 3-2-1 for 迴圈結構 3-2-2 while 迴圈指令 3-2-3 do-while 迴圈指令 3-3 流程控制指令 3-3-1 break 指令 3-3-2 continue 指令 3-4 本章相關模擬試題 CHAPTER|04|陣列、字串、矩陣、結構與檔案 4-1 陣列簡介 4-1-1 一維陣列 4-1-2 二維陣列 4-1-3 多維陣列 4-2 字串 4-2-1 字串陣列 4-3 矩陣 4-3-1 矩陣相加演算法 4-3-2 矩陣相乘演算法 4-3-3 轉置矩陣演算法 4-4 結構(Structure) 4-4-1 結構宣告與存取 4-4-2 巢狀結構 4-4-3 結構陣列 4-5 檔案簡介 4-5-1 fopen() 函數與 fclose() 函數 4-5-2 fputc() 函數與 fgetc() 函數 4-5-3 fpus() 函數與 fgets() 函數 4-6 本章相關模擬試題 CHAPTER|05|函數 5-1 認識函數 5-1-1 函數原型宣告 5-1-2 定義函數主體 5-2 參數傳遞方式 5-2-1 傳值呼叫 5-2-2 傳址呼叫 5-2-3 陣列參數傳遞 5-3 本章相關模擬試題 CHAPTER|06|指標與串列 6-1 認識指標 6-1-1 宣告指標變數 6-1-2 多重指標 6-1-3 指標運算 6-1-4 指標與陣列 6-1-5 指標與字串 6-2 串列結構 6-2-1 建立單向串列 6-2-2 走訪單向串列 6-2-3 單向串列插入新節點 6-2-4 單向串列刪除節點 6-2-5 單向串列的反轉 6-3 環狀串列 6-3-1 環狀串列的建立與走訪 6-3-2 環狀串列的插入新節點 6-3-3 環狀串列的刪除節點 6-4 雙向串列 6-4-1 雙向串列的建立與走訪 6-5 本章相關模擬試題 CHAPTER|07|必考演算法解析與實作 7-1 演算法簡介 7-1-1 演算法表示方式 7-1-2 演算法效能分析 7-2 APCS 必備演算法 7-2-1 分治演算法 7-2-2 遞迴演算法 - 費伯納數列 7-2-3 遞迴演算法 - 河內塔問題 7-2-4 動態規劃演算法 7-2-5 貪心演算法 7-2-6 巴斯卡三角形演算法 7-2-7 枚舉演算法 7-2-8 回溯演算法 - 老鼠走迷宮 7-3 排序演算法 7-3-1 氣泡排序法 7-3-2 快速排序法 7-4 搜尋演算法 7-4-1 循序搜尋演算法 7-4-2 二分搜尋演算法 7-5 本章相關模擬試題 CHAPTER|08|基礎資料結構導論 8-1 堆疊 8-1-1 陣列實作堆疊 8-2 佇列 8-2-1 陣列實作佇列 8-2-2 環狀佇列 8-2-3 雙向佇列 8-3 樹狀結構 8-3-1 樹的基本觀念 8-3-2 二元樹 8-3-3 陣列實作二元樹 8-3-4 串列實作二元樹 8-3-5 二元樹走訪 8-3-6 二元搜尋樹 8-3-7 堆積樹 ...

原價: 690 售價: 587 現省: 103元
立即查看
APCS大學程式設計先修檢測完勝教材: 使用C & Python (1版)

APCS大學程式設計先修檢測完勝教材: 使用C & Python (1版)

類似書籍推薦給您

第1章 C語言開發環境與程式基本觀念  1.1 Code::Blocks整合開發環境介紹  1.2 C語言的程式架構  1.3 常值與資料型別  1.4 識別字  1.5 變數和常數的宣告  1.6 運算子  1.7 型別轉換與轉型  1.8 變數的生命期 第2章 C語言輸出入函式  2.1 前言  2.2 printf()輸出函式  2.3 scanf()輸入函式  2.4 字元輸入、輸出函式  2.5 字串輸入、輸出函式 第3章 C語言程式流程控制  3.1 前言  3.2 關係運算式  3.3 邏輯運算式  3.4 選擇結構  3.5 多向選擇 switch  3.6 條件運算式  3.7 重複結構  3.8 中斷迴圈  3.9 無窮迴圈 第4章 C語言陣列  4.1 陣列  4.2 陣列的宣告與使用  4.3 二維陣列  4.4 字串陣列  4.5 氣泡排序法  4.6 陣列的搜尋 第5章 C語言函式  5.1 函式  5.2 內建函式  5.3 自定函式  5.4 傳值呼叫與傳址呼叫  5.5 如何在函式間傳遞陣列資料  5.6 變數的儲存類別 第6章 C語言遞迴  6.1 遞迴  6.2 數列  6.3 階乘  6.4 最大公因數  6.5 費氏數列  6.6 組合  6.7 堆疊  6.8 多遞迴 第7章 APCS觀念題解析 - 使用C解題 第8章 Python開發環境與程式基本觀念  8.1 IDLE整合開發環境介紹  8.2 Python語言的架構  8.3 內建資料型別  8.4 常值  8.5 變數與數值資料型別  8.6 運算子  8.7 資料型別轉換 第9章 Python字串與輸出入函式  9.1 字串資料型別  9.2 字串與運算子  9.3 格式化輸出  9.4 常用的字串方法  9.5 資料夾的建立與刪除  9.6 檔案的開啟與關閉  9.7 文字檔資料的寫入與讀取  9.8 例外處理 第10章 Python流程控制  10.1 結構化程式設計  10.2 條件式  10.3 選擇結構  10.4 重覆結構 第11章 Python 串列  11.1 何謂串列  11.2 一維串列  11.3 串列的函式與方法  11.4 串列與for迴圈  11.5 多維串列  11.5 串列的排序  11.6 氣泡排序法  11.7 串列與字串 第12章 Python函式與遞迴  12.1 函式  12.2 內建函式  12.3 自定函式  12.4 全域變數與區域變數  12.5 資料的傳遞方式  12.6 遞迴 第13章 APCS 105 年 3 月實作題解析 - 使用Python解題  13.1 成績指標  13.2 矩陣轉換  13.3 線段覆蓋長度  13.4 血緣關係 第14章 APCS 105 年 10 月實作題解析 - 使用Python解題  14.1 三角形辨別  14.2 最大和  14.3 定時K 彈  14.4 棒球遊戲 第15章 APCS 106 年 3 月實作題解析 - 使用Python解題  15.1 秘密差  15.2 小群體  15.3 數字龍捲風  15.4 基地台 第16章 APCS 106 年 10 月實作題解析 - 使用Python解題  16.1 邏輯運算子  16.2 交錯字串  16.3 樹狀圖分析  16.4 物品堆疊 附錄 A 安裝 Code::Blocks 整合開發環境 〔電子書,請線上下載〕 附錄 B 安裝 Python IDLE 整合開發環境 〔電子書,請線上下載〕

原價: 500 售價: 425 現省: 75元
立即查看
APCS 7級必勝秘笈:學習、練習、突破|觀念題C+實作題Python

APCS 7級必勝秘笈:學習、練習、突破|觀念題C+實作題Python

類似書籍推薦給您

【簡介】 ★「APCS大學程式設計先修檢測」培養運算思維能力,為學習歷程加分! ★依據坐7級望8級的考試策略編寫的APCS專書,運用APCS申請國立大學。 ★觀念題C+實作題Python:學習C加強程式設計、資料結構及演算法的知識;以Python實作磨練程式設計功力。 本書特色 ★目標定位清晰:為預備挑戰APCS學科4級與術科3級而設計,協助學生以7級以上的成績,順利進入理想大學的資訊科系。 ★策略性學習:根據「坐7級望8級」的考試策略精心編寫,提供從基礎到進階的全面學習指南。 學科+術科的系統訓練 ★學科策略: •深入淺出,系統性地介紹學科概念,使學習和練習更加有效率。 •積極準備不僅可達成4級目標,同時開啟邁向5級的可能。 ★術科攻略: •基礎篇:從基本題目開始,確保清楚理解重點題型,確實實作,3級目標輕鬆達成。 •進階篇:將複雜題目拆解為易懂的子問題,逐步建立解題技巧和自信,為挑戰4級及5級做好充分準備。 •實戰演練:通過反覆練習,使學生在考場上能夠鎮定自若,有效應對各種題型,高分通過考試。 【目錄】 CH01 認識APCS 1.1 APCS 準備策略 1.2 設定有效率的學習目標與準備計劃 CH02 觀念題如何考4級分 2.1 C語言簡介 2.2 C語言快速入門 2.3 遞迴(C語言版) 2.4 APCS 觀念題分類 2.5 APCS 使用概念、技巧統計 2.6 APCS 觀念題實例演習 CH03 如何輕鬆實作題考3級分 3.1 程式設計學Python語言的好處 3.2 Python語言快速入門 3.3 10個Python執行階段錯誤訊息與原因 3.4 使用Python Help文件 3.5 Python的字串應用 3.6 List、Set、Dict等好用資料型態熟悉 3.7 列表推導式(list comprehension) 3.8 輸出的技巧 CH04 基本資料結構、演算法 4.1 暴力窮舉法 4.2 搜尋演算法 4.3 排序演算法 4.4 堆疊資料結構 4.5 佇列資料結構 4.6 遞迴(Python版) CH05 APCS實例演習(I) CH6 挑戰APCS8級分以上 6.1 貪心演算法 6.2 分治演算法 6.3 動態規劃演算法 6.4 樹狀結構應用 6.5 圖形結構應用 6.6 指標 CH07 APCS實例演習(II) CH08 觀摩題

原價: 450 售價: 383 現省: 67元
立即查看
APCS x Python解題思路 (2版)

APCS x Python解題思路 (2版)

類似書籍推薦給您

【簡介】 ◎詳細解析歷屆APCS試題,掌握運算思維和程式設計技巧 ◎深入剖析觀念題,解釋選項的對錯原因,全面掌握考試要點 ◎完整解說實作題,以七大架構解題,包括程式碼和測試結果 ◎適合初學者自學使用,快速提升應試能力 《Python × APCS解題思路》是一本針對大學程式設計先修檢測(APCS)設計的實用指南。本書涵蓋了APCS歷年公告的三屆觀念題及四屆實作題,並以簡單易懂的文字和清晰的流程圖分析考題的解題方向。讀者可以先以紙筆演練,理解各題的運算思維脈絡與原理後,再開始編寫程式來完成解題。本書採用Python語言作為工具,著重於運算思維的訓練,即使不進行上機寫程式,也能用紙和筆解題。 本書的實作題架構包含七個部分:問題描述、範例說明、思考方向、流程圖、Python程式、程式說明及程式測試。透過這七大結構,讀者可以系統性地掌握解題過程中的每一個步驟,並確保程式碼的正確性。此外,針對觀念題,本書詳細解釋每個選項的對錯理由,並提供完整的程式演算過程。 本書的編排設計適合初學者和有一定基礎的學習者。初學者可以根據書中的學習進度逐步學習Python語言,同步進行APCS題目的解題訓練。而有基礎的讀者則可利用本書進行自我挑戰,測試在有限時間內完成題目的能力。本書能幫助讀者扎實掌握運算思維和Python程式設計技巧,為APCS檢測做好充分準備。 【目錄】 Chapter 0 APCS 簡介與學習進度 0-1 APCS 簡介 0-2 學習進度 Chapter 1 / 觀念題 / 2016 年03 月 Chapter 2 / 觀念題 / 2016 年10 月 Chapter 3 / 觀念題 / 2017 年03 月 Chapter 4 / 實作題 / 2016 年03 月 4-1 成績指標 4-2 矩陣轉換 4-3 線段覆蓋長度 4-4 血緣關係 Chapter 5 / 實作題 / 2016 年10 月 5-1 三角形辨別 5-2 最大和 5-3 定時K 彈 5-4 棒球遊戲 Chapter 6 / 實作題 / 2017 年03 月 6-1 秘密差 6-2 小群體 6-3 數字龍捲風 6-4 基地台 Chapter 7 / 實作題 / 2017 年10 月 7-1 邏輯運算子 7-2 交錯字串 7-3 樹狀圖分析 7-4 物品堆疊

原價: 420 售價: 370 現省: 50元
立即查看